FireFox Ram Fresser

posted by Webby0815
Mrz 4

Firefox Tipps: Den Speicherverbrauch optimieren und reduzieren

Den Speicherverbrauch von Firefox reduzieren und die Arbeitsgeschwindigkeit auf lange Sicht erhöhen? Wer intensiv mit Firefox arbeitet, den werden wohl auf Dauer ähnlich oder gleiche Probleme quälen wie mich. Nach einigen Stunden intensiver Arbeit mit Dutzenden geöffneten Browser-Tabs wird Firefox immer langsamer und ein Blick in den Task-Manager zeigt, dass der Speicherverbrauch so langsam astronomische Höhen erreicht.

In den folgenden Schritten möchte ich kurz erklären, wie ich meinen Firefox konfiguriert habe, um den Speicherverbrauch etwas zu reduzieren und den Browser auch langfristig optimal zu nutzen.

1. Extensions
Wer wie ich dazu neigt, sich gerne das ein oder andere Add-On zu installieren, sollte genau prüfen, welche er davon schlussendlich wirklich braucht. Unnötige und Speicherbelastende Spielereien müssen nicht sein und man kann getrost darauf verzichten. Nach Durchsicht meiner Add-Ons habe ich mich von gut der Hälfte erst einmal getrennt und nur noch wirklich diejenigen übrig gelassen, die ich zur täglichen Arbeit bzw. Arbeitserleichterung auch benötige. Unnötiger Schnickschnack flog direkt raus, so kann man z.B. auf Dinge wie DummyIpsum verzichten, da es dafür auch einen Online-Generator gibt, der genauso schnell aufgerufen und verwendet werden kann, wie das Firefox Add-On.

Grundlegend also erst einmal Firefox ordentlich entmisten und alles raus, was keine Miete zahlt, denn mit 30-40 oder mehr installieren Erweiterungen bringen alle folgenden Tipps und Einstellungen nur sehr wenig bis rein gar nichts.

2. Download-Chronik löschen und deaktivieren
Die Download-Chronik ist standardgemäß aktiviert in Firefox, wird aber eigentlich nicht wirklich benötigt und schafft unnötigen Ballast. Bei vielen täglichen Downloads verbraucht diese Chronik sogar recht viel Speicher und kann den Browser verlangsamen oder gar einfrieren.

Zuerst löschen wir einmal die vorhandene Download-Chronik. Dazu auf Extras›Einstellungen und dann den Tab “Datenschutz” auswählen. Unter “Private Daten” den Button “Jetzt löschen” klicken und im Auswahlfenster alles deaktivieren bis auf “Download-Chronik” und anschließend “Private Daten jetzt löschen” ausführen.
Nun ändern wir die Einstellungen der Download-Chronik und deaktivieren diese. Dazu im gleichen Fenster (Datenschutz) unter Chronik die Option “Heruntergeladene Dateien merken” deaktivieren
Wer auf die Chronik (Liste aller in einem bestimmten Zeitraum besuchter Webseiten) verzichten kann (und das können eigentlich die meisten), der deaktiviert auch diese Option, da bei einem Speicher-Intervall von z.B. 9 Tagen ebenfalls eine beträchtliche Liste zusammen kommen kann. Also ebenfalls die Option “Besuchte Seiten speichern für die letzten xx Tage” deaktivieren

3. Feste Speicher-Cache-Größe zuweisen
Firefox verwendet unabhängig von der Größe des System-Speichers einen Speicher-Cache. Da der Speicher-Cache keine feste Größe eingestellt hat, sollte diese abhängig vom System-Speicher fest eingestellt werden.

In der Adressleiste “about:config” eingeben und damit die Firefox Konfiguration aufrufen.
Zuerst kontrollieren ob der System-Cache auch aktiviert ist. Dazu in der Zeile Filter “browser.cache.memory.enable” eingeben und mit Return bestätigen.

Die Option “browser.cache.memory.enable” sollte bei Wert standardgemäß “true” eingestellt haben. Sollte dies nicht der Fall sein, die Option mit Doppelklick öffnen und den Wert auf “true” ändern.
Nun mit Rechtsklick das Kontextmenü öffnen und dann Neu›Integer auswählen.

Im Fenster “Neuer integer-Wert” nun “browser.cache.memory.capacity” eingeben und mit “OK” bestätigen.

Im Fenster “Geben Sie einen integer-Wert ein” nun abhängig vom eigenen System-Speicher die Größe des Speicher-Cache in KBytes angeben.

Hier eine Auflistung der System-Cache integer-Werte nach Größe des eigenen System-Speichers:
256MB RAM = “4096” (entsprechen 4MB System-Cache)
512MB RAM = “8192” (entsprechen 8MB System-Cache)
1024MB RAM = “16384” (entsprechen 16MB System-Cache)
2048MB RAM = “32768” (entsprechen 32MB System-Cache)
4096MB RAM = “65536” (entsprechen 64MB System-Cache)
Firefox neu starten.
Für den Fall, das die Default-Settings wieder hergestellt werden sollen, sprich keine fest eingestellte System-Cache-Größe mehr, den integer-Wert bei “browser.cache.memory.capacity” auf “-1” ändern.

4. Speicher freigeben, sobald Firefox minimiert ist
Mit Hilfe einer zusätzlichen Option in der Firefox-Konfiguration kann man den Browser veranlassen, von ihm verwendeten Speicher teilweise freizugeben, sobald der Browser minimiert wird.

In der Adressleiste “about:config” eingeben und damit die Firefox Konfiguration aufrufen.

Nun mit Rechtsklick das Kontextmenü öffnen und dann Neu›Boolean auswählen.

Im Fenster “Neuer boolean-Wert” nun “config.trim_on_minimize” eingeben und mit “OK” bestätigen.

Im Fenster “Geben Sie einen boolean-Wert ein” den Wert “true” auswählen und mit “OK” bestätigen.

Firefox neu starten.

5. Tab Mix Plus Session Manager & Firefox regelmäßig neu starten
So dämlich das jetzt klingen mag, der wichtigste Schritt bei all den Optimierungen ist Firefox in bestimmten Abständen einfach einmal zu beenden und wieder neu zu starten. Firefox frisst sich im Langzeitbetrieb irgendwann eben einfach mal voll und dies lässt sich leider auch nicht vermeiden. Daher starte ich z.B. Firefox in Abständen von 2-3 Stunden einfach einmal neu und habe so den von Firefox belegten Speicher erst einmal komplett geleert. Nun ist es aber meist so, dass man mitten in der Arbeit entsprechend viele Tabs und Fenster geöffnet hat und nicht gerade große Lust verspürt, den Browser zu schließen, um dann alle einzelnen Seiten noch einmal aufrufen zu müssen. Hier kommt einem ein Addon zu Gute, welches viele vielleicht schon installiert haben. Die Rede ist von Tab Mix Plus.

Dieses Add-On verfügt über eine sehr nützliche Option, welche die Firefox eigene Funktion “SessionStore” (SessionStore stellt eine durch Absturz oder einfrieren verursachte Session-Unterbrechung beim Neustart von Firefox wieder her und alle zuvor geöffneten Fenster werden erneut geladen), auf Wunsch durch Tab Mix Session Manager ersetzen kann. Der eindeutige Vorteil des Tab Mix Session Manager gegenüber dem Firefox eigenen Built-in ist die Tatsache, dass der Tab Mix Session Manager je nach Einstellung nach jedem Neustart die vorangegangene Session wieder herstellt, während der Firefox eigene SessionStore nur nach unfreiwilligen Abstürzen eine Wiederherstellung vornimmt.

Zuerst einmal also Tab Mix Plus installieren.
Nach der Installation und dem Neustart über Extras die Tab Mix Plus Options aufrufen.
Im Options-Fenster nun “Session” auswählen und dort von “Built-in SessionStore” auf “Tab Mix Session Manager” umschalten. Die weiteren Einstellungen anhand des folgenden Screenshots vornehmen und mit “Apply” bestätigen und mit “OK” die Optionen schließen.Nun kann man in regelmäßigen Abständen den Browser einfach einmal schließen und neu starten und die vor Beendigung geöffnete Session wird mit allen Tabs und Fenstern unverzüglich wieder hergestellt. So hat Firefox erst gar keine Chance den Speicher übermäßig zu beanspruchen und das System unnötig auszulasten.

 

Für denjenigen dem das zuviel Arbeit ist ,der kann einfach dieses Tool laden firetune12 entpacken und ausfühen…..


One Response to “FireFox Ram Fresser”

  1. [...] den Originalbeitrag weiterlesen: Webmasters-Blog.de … für Webmaster …und die,die es werden … Medien zum Thema   Medien by [...]

Leave a Reply

*